Leestijd : 1 minuten

Beste ontwikkelingsplatforms voor mobiele apps in 2022

Een Mobile App Development Platform (MADP) is software waarmee u mobiele applicaties kunt ontwerpen, bouwen, testen en implementeren. Het geeft ontwikkelaars de mogelijkheid om meer apps toe te voegen door eerdere codes te hergebruiken en geeft hen controle over de geïmplementeerde app-oplossingen. Bedrijven hebben meestal hun eigen MADP of kopen een van de producten van derden die we in dit artikel zullen bespreken. Het omvat backend-as-a-service, frontend-tools en applicatieprogrammeringsservices.  

De term MADP is bedacht door Gartner en vervangt eerder gebruikte termen als Mobile Enterprise Application Platform (MEAP) en Mobile Consumer Application Platform (MCAP). Dit komt omdat MADP functioneler is gebleken dan MEAP en MCAP afzonderlijk waren. Met MADP kunnen ontwikkelaars apps aanpassen zonder handmatige wijzigingen in de backend, omdat ze een configureerbare verbinding met bedrijfsgegevens hebben. Met MADP hoeft slechts één codebase te worden onderhouden op meerdere platforms, apparaten en netwerken. 

De juiste mobiele app kiezen ontwikkelingsplatform kan lastig zijn, daarom hebben we een vergelijking gemaakt tussen de topplatforms die momenteel op de markt zijn en die nieuwste mobiele trends.  

1. Fladderen 

Met Flutter ‘bouw apps voor elk scherm’. Flutter is een open-source framework van Google voor het bouwen van multi-platform, native en prachtig ontworpen applicaties vanuit een enkele codebase. Het framework is snel, flexibel en productief, waardoor snelle weergave ensnelle ontwikkeling van apps mogelijk is op elk platform, of het nu mobiel of web is. Het bestuurt ook de codebase met geautomatiseerde tests voor hoogwaardige app-prestaties. Bovendien gebruikt het Dart als taal die is geoptimaliseerd om snelle apps te produceren. Flutter wordt een gemakkelijke keuze voor elke ontwikkelaar, aangezien het een betrouwbaar platform is en ze altijd gemakkelijk hulp kunnen vinden voor al hun vragen in de wereldwijde ontwikkelaarscommunity van Google. Heel wat populaire bedrijven gebruiken Flutter om hun apps te ontwikkelen. De app voor Groupon, met hoofdkantoor in Chicago, is bijvoorbeeld gebouwd met Flutter. Voor het geval je op zoek bent, hier is een samengestelde lijst voor top app-ontwikkelaars in Chicago.

Apps ontwikkeld met Flutter – Google Pay, Toyota, Google Ads 

2. Mendix 

Mendix is een low-code mobiel ontwikkelingsplatform dat populair is voor het ontwikkelen van apps op schaal en snelheid. Het claimt zichzelf als leider in de ontwikkeling van mobiele apps voor bedrijven en dat is ook echt zo, dankzij de krachtige cloudarchitectuur, intelligente automatisering en gegevensintegratie. Het fungeert als een platform voor iedereen met een idee om een app te bouwen – zowel bedrijven als individuele ontwikkelaars. Ideevorming tot implementatie wordt een soepel proces met Mendix wat een geïntegreerd platform is dat zowel low-code als tooling zonder code. Het vereenvoudigt de ontwikkeling van applicaties en stelt de gebruiker in staat om kunstmatige intelligentie voor slimme apps te verkennen en visuele contactpunten te creëren die klanttevredenheid garanderen.  

Apps ontwikkeld met < /span>MendixAntTail’s app voor het volgen van medicijnen, de RFID-polsband van de Solomon Group, KLM en Heijman’s IoT gebaseerde apps 

3. Xamarin 

Xamarin van Microsoft werd geïntroduceerd in 2011 en is tot op de dag van vandaag een populaire keuze voorplatformonafhankelijke applicatie-ontwikkeling voor iOS, Android en Windows met C#-codebase. De compatibiliteit met het .Net-framework is een van de grootste voordelen. Het maakt gebruik van native componenten voor een native app-achtige ervaring. Xamarin richt zich op verbeterde functionaliteit en snelheid, zodat apps aanvoelen alsof ze native zijn. Het vereenvoudigt app-updates en ontwikkelaars kunnen aan meerdere projecten werken, aangezien twee apps tegelijkertijd kunnen worden bijgewerkt. Met behulp van Microsoft Visual Studio krijgen ontwikkelaars toegang tot alle ontwikkelfuncties en -tools van Xamarin.  

Het heeft een van de beste backend-infrastructuren die minder bugs produceren. Testen kan op een willekeurig aantal apparaten vanwege de cloudservices.  

Apps ontwikkeld met Xamarin – Alaska Airlines, de Wereldbank  

4. Ionisch 

Ionic is een gratis en open-source platform dat geoptimaliseerde UI-componenten, gebaren en tools biedt voor zeer interactieve apps. Het bevat vooraf ontworpen UI-componenten die er fantastisch uitzien op elk scherm en heeft een basisthema dat zich aanpast aan elk platform. Met de nieuwste versie heeft Ionic nog meer UI-elementen en iOS/Android-ontwerpverbeteringen toegevoegd. ‘Een keer schrijven, overal uitvoeren’ – Ionic stelt ontwikkelaars in staat om apps naar de app store en als PWA te brengen met een enkele codebase. Ionic CLI is ontwikkelaarsvriendelijk en maakt live herladen, integratie, implementaties enzovoort mogelijk.  

Het staat algemeen bekend als een tool voor het ontwikkelen van hybride mobiele apps en progressieve web-apps die volledige controle geeft over de app gebouw. Bovendien? Je kunt op Ionic bouwen met elke techstack, inclusief Angular, React, Vue of zelfs alleen JavaScript. 

Apps ontwikkeld met Ionic – General Electric, EA Sports 

5. Reageer native 

De meeste bedrijven gebruiken React Native omdat de meeste code in JavaScript kan worden geschreven en kan worden gedeeld tussen Android en iOS zonder twee verschillende codebases te gebruiken. Geïntroduceerd door Facebook in 2015, is de herbruikbaarheid van code een van de belangrijkste redenen voor zijn populariteit. Dit versnelt het volledige app-ontwikkelingsproces. Live-herlaadfuncties maken het de ontwikkelaars gemakkelijk om codewijzigingen in realtime aan te brengen, waardoor iteraties razendsnel plaatsvinden. React Native is compatibel met native software, waardoor het geschikt is voor het toevoegen van extensies aan native applicaties. Het is een van de grootste community’s onder cross-platforms die ondersteuning voor ontwikkelaars, uitgebreide bibliotheken, livechat en tutorials biedt.  

Apps ontwikkeld met React Native – Facebook, Instagram, Pinterest 

6. Adobe PhoneGap

PhoneGap, voorheen bekend als Apache Cordova, is een open-source desktoptoepassing die helpt bij het ontwikkelen van afzonderlijke apps die op elk mobiel apparaat kunnen werken. Het werkt effectief op HTML5, JavaScript en CSS3. Het is ideaal om mobiele apps te ontwikkelen door de functionaliteit uit te breiden naar bestaande apps in plaats van helemaal opnieuw te werken. Een sterk hoogtepunt is dat de consistentie behouden blijft, ongeacht welk platform. Apps die op dit platform zijn ontwikkeld, hebben de mogelijkheid om als native apps te fungeren en bieden uitzonderlijke UX-elementen. Het heeft een plug-in-architectuur die compatibel is voor het toevoegen van native functionaliteiten aan de apps.

Apps ontwikkeld met Adobe PhoneGap – Wikipedia, Paylution

7. Sencha

Sencha SDK’s zijn gebaseerd op HTML5, wat het voor ontwikkelaars mogelijk maakt om boeiende gebruikerservaringen en animaties te bouwen. Sencha Ext JS is een JavaScript-platform dat een rijke gebruikersinterface, uitgebreide bibliotheken en goed geschreven API’s biedt voor het bouwen van zeer responsieve en gegevensintensieve applicaties. Het heeft de mogelijkheid om zware gegevens te beheren en pronkt met een onberispelijke gegevensweergave. Ook als de vraag is naar een platform dat animatie en touch-evenementen ondersteunt, is Sencha het antwoord.

Apps gebouwd met Sencha – Samsung, Nvidia

Conclusie:

Traditionele ontwikkelingsmodellen voor mobiele apps kunnen niet voldoen aan de behoefte aan slimme en moderne apps die constant dynamische veranderingen zoeken. Dit is waar MADP centraal staat door snelle ontwikkeling en naadloze implementatie van mobiele apps mogelijk te maken die kunnen voldoen aan de veranderende marktvereisten.

Wilt u relevante apps ontwikkelen in concurrerende tijdsbestekken en tegen betaalbare kosten? Partner met Zuci vandaag!

Sharon Mariam Koshy

Loves getting creative with mundane topics in addition to geeking out over books and movies.

Deel deze blog, kies uw platform!

Leave A Comment

gerelateerde berichten